The following is my report from the evening court of Their Excellencies,
Geldamar and Etain, Baron and Baroness Nottinghill Coill held in the Canton
of Ritterwald at Alhhard Manor during Nottinghill Coill War Practice.
The Court of Their Excellencies was opened with Their Excellencies welcoming
the populace and thanking the Canton of Ritterwald for hosting this fine
event.
Their Excellencies summoned before them m'ladies Elise and Virginia before
them who presented Their Excellencies with two rare eggs that they had
happened upon while hunting in the woods.
Their Excellencies then bade all the children present come before them where
They presented gifts of bubbles to them.
Lord Draco of Brockore Abby was summoned before Their Excellencies and
Baron Geldamar spoke upon Lord Draco's service to the Barony and presented
him with the Baron's Award of Excellence.
Their Excellencies then summoned Darius of Nottinghill Coill before Them and
praised his skill as archer and noted that he had shot well that day even
out shooting His Excellency Himself and was presented with the medallion of
the rank of Archer.
The newcomers were then called into Court and were presented with largess
from Their Excellencies and warmly thanked for attending and They shared
Their wish that they would continue to participate in our Barony.
At this time Lord Axum O'Neal who had been hard at work in the kitchen all
day was called before Her Excellency who spoke upon his virtues and
unceasing courtesy and hence presented him with the Baroness' Award of
Courtesy.
The Event Steward Lord Diederich Von Basel was summoned into court to
announce the winners of the archery tournament. Lord Diederich's brother was
then called into court and they were both presented with a birthday cake in
honor of their birthday that day.
Lady Arielle of Beinn Dhubh was then summoned before Their Exellencies who
spoke on the fact that she seems to not have stood still and having provided
much service to the Barony and They were minded to award her for such.
At this time The Order of the Gordian Knot was summoned into court and Lady
Arielle was admitted as a Companion of the Order was bade to rise and greet
her new order.
The last business was the announcement that at War of the Wings, Nottinghill
Coill will not declare a side but will remain neutral to allow the
individuals and groups within the Barony to fight with whoever they wished
without worry.
There being no further business the Court of Their Excellences was then
closed
